Management's Comments on Q1 2024

管理层对2024年第一季度的评论

Jeffrey Hasham, the Company's Chief Executive Officer, noted "We are very pleased with our start to 2024, with Q1 2024 EBITDA of $4.0 million Canadian, even with lower paper prices. When we look at EBITDA less net recycling revenue, this was $2.3 million Canadian compared to $1.8 million Canadian in Q1 2023, which speaks to our continued operational improvements. From a revenue perspective, we continue to see demand for our shredding services, with shredding revenue growth of 12% versus Q1 2023. Proscan, our digital imaging business, also started the year strong with revenue growth of 47% versus Q1 2023.

Quarterly Highlights:

季度亮点:

Consolidated Highlights:

综合亮点:

  • The Company generated revenue of $17.2 million CAD, with shredding revenue growing by $1.5 million CAD, or 12% versus Q1 2023.
  • Consolidated EBITDA excluding the impact of net recycling revenue was $2.3 million CAD, growing by $0.5 million CAD, or 31% versus Q1 2023.
  • The Company generated free cash flow of $0.9 million CAD, decreasing by 64% versus Q1 2023, primarily due to lower net recycling revenue due to lower commodity paper prices and timing of capital expenditures for shredding trucks.
  • Consolidated EBITDA was $4.0 million CAD, declining by 15% versus Q1 2023, driven by lower net recycling revenue due to lower commodity paper prices.

Corporate Locations Highlights:

公司地点亮点:

  • Corporate location revenue grew 1% versus Q1 2023 to $16.6 million CAD (2% constant currency growth - US Dollars is the constant currency).
  • Corporate location EBITDA declined by 5% versus Q1 2023 to $5.7 million CAD (5% constant currency decrease). The decline is driven by lower net recycling revenue due to lower commodity paper prices.
  • Same corporate location EBITDA declined 7% versus Q1 2023 to $5.6 million CAD (7% constant currency decrease). The decline is driven by lower net recycling revenue due to lower commodity paper prices.

Acquisitions

收购

  • On January 2, 2024, the Company acquired the assets of MDK Recycling LLC ("MDK") for cash consideration of $0.7 million CAD and contingent consideration of $0.3 million CAD. MDK is a Michigan-based business which offers paper and hard drive shredding, product destruction, paper recycling and scanning services. The acquisition of MDK allows the Company to expand its geographical footprint in the Midwest to now encompass Michigan.

Revenue Growth in Q1 2024

2024 年第一季度收入增长

The Company achieved 1% revenue growth during Q1 2024 versus Q1 2023 primarily due to acquisitions conducted and organic sales growth from new customers, partially offset by a decrease in recycling revenue from lower commodity paper prices.

Corporate Locations Q1 2024 Performance

公司地点 2024 年第一季度业绩

Total corporate location revenue grew by 1% and EBITDA declined by 5% in Q1 2024 versus Q1 2023. Revenue grew due to acquisitions conducted and organic sales growth from new customers partially offset by a decrease in recycling revenue from lower commodity paper prices. EBITDA declined due to the decrease in recycling revenue from lower commodity paper prices.

与2023年第一季度相比,2024年第一季度的公司办公地点总收入增长了1%,息税折旧摊销前利润下降了5%。由于进行了收购,而来自新客户的有机销售增长部分抵消了大宗商品纸价格下跌导致的回收收入的减少,收入的增长被部分抵消。由于大宗商品纸价格下跌导致回收收入减少,息税折旧摊销前利润下降。

Same corporate location operating income, excluding the impact of net recycling revenue, grew 82% in Q1 2024 versus Q1 2023. Same corporate location shredding revenue grew by 6% in Q1 2024 versus Q1 2023, with same corporate location EBITDA declining by 7%, driven by decrease in paper commodity prices.

Non-IFRS Measures

非国际财务报告准则指标

There are measures included in this press release that do not have a standardized meaning under International Financial Reporting Standards ("IFRS") and therefore may not be comparable to similarly titled measures presented by other publicly traded companies. The Company includes these measures as a means of measuring financial performance of the Company.

本新闻稿中包含的某些指标在《国际财务报告准则》(“IFRS”)下没有标准化含义,因此可能无法与其他上市公司提出的类似标题的指标相提并论。公司将这些指标列为衡量公司财务业绩的一种手段。

  • Total System Sales are sales generated by franchisees, licensees and corporately operated locations. The system sales generated by franchisees and licensees drive the Company's royalties. The system sales generated by corporate locations are included in the Company's revenue.
  • Same Location are indicators of performance of corporately operated locations that have been in the system for equivalent periods in both the current period and the comparative period.
  • Consolidated EBITDA is defined as earnings before interest, taxes, depreciation and amortization. Consolidated EBITDA also excludes government assistance, re-measurements of contingent consideration, foreign exchange gains and losses, and gains and losses on disposal of tangible assets. A reconciliation between net income and consolidated EBITDA is provided below.
  • Consolidated EBITDA less Net Recycling is defined as the consolidated EBITDA excluding the impact of corporate location recycling sales, net of paper baling costs. A reconciliation between net income and consolidated EBITDA less net recycling is provided below.
  • Consolidated Operating Income is defined as revenues less all operating expenses, including depreciation on tangible assets. Amortization for intangible assets has not been included in this calculation. A reconciliation between net income and consolidated operating income is provided below.
  • Consolidated Free Cash Flow is defined as cash provided by operating activities net of capital expenditures. The calculation of Consolidated Free Cash Flow that begins with cash provided by operating activities is provided below.
  • Capital Expenditures is defined as the purchase of tangible and intangible assets, net of proceeds received from their disposal.
  • Corporate Location EBITDA is defined as earnings for corporately operated locations before interest, taxes, depreciation and amortization and also excludes items identified under the definition of Consolidated EBITDA above.
  • Corporate Location Operating Income is the operating income generated by corporately operated locations. The operating income generated is inclusive of depreciation on tangible assets, including trucks, right-of-use-assets and secure collection containers. It does not include amortization related to intangibles assets and interest expense.
  • Corporate Location Operating Income less Net Recycling is the corporate location operating income excluding the impact of corporate location recycling sales, net of paper baling costs.
  • Corporate Location EBITDA less Net Recycling is the corporate location EBITDA excluding the impact of corporate location recycling sales, net of paper baling costs.
  • Margin is the percentage of revenue that has turned into EBITDA or Operating Income. Margin is defined as EBITDA or operating income divided by revenue.
  • Constant currency is a measure of growth before foreign currency translation impacts. It is defined as the current period results in CAD currency using the foreign exchange rate in the equivalent prior year period. This allows for period over period comparisons of business performance excluding the impact of currency fluctuations.

About Redishred Capital Corp.

关于雷迪希雷德资本公司

Redishred Capital Corp. ("Redishred") is the owner of the PROSHRED, PROSCAN and secure e-Cycle brands, trademarks and intellectual property in the United States. Redishred digitizes, secures, shreds and recycles confidential documents and proprietary materials for thousands of customers in the United States in all industry sectors. Redishred is a pioneer in the mobile document destruction and recycling industry and has the ISO 9001:2015 certification. It is Redishred's vision to be the 'system of choice' in providing digital retention, secure shredding and recycling services on a global basis. Redishred Capital Corp. grants PROSHRED` and PROSCAN franchise businesses in the United States and by way of a license arrangement in the Middle East. Redishred also operates seventeen corporate businesses directly. The Company's plan is to grow its business by way of both franchising and the acquisition and operation of information security businesses that generate stable and recurring cash flow through a scheduled client base, continuous paper recycling and concurrent unscheduled shredding service.
